Sergey Bezrukov
Sergey Bezrukov is a famous Russian theater and film actor. The actor received the greatest popularity due to his role in the series "The Brigade", where he played one of the main roles. He is loved and respected not only in Russia but also abroad. In addition to filming a movie, Sergey Bezrukov plays in the theater, and also works as a theater director.
Dmitry Pevtsov
Russian male actor Dmitry Pevtsov is known for all his playing in the rock opera Juno and Avos. Dmitry began acting in films in 1986, but his first film did not receive wide popularity. After that, he played in a large number of series and feature films. Dmitry Pevtsov in most cases plays positive roles. His characters is an image of an honest and hard-working Russian man who is a little rude, but with a kind and open soul.
Danila Kozlovsky
The young Russian actor Danila Kozlovsky, unlike many famous people, very often plays the role of negative characters (Russian men). However, this does not prevent the actor from enjoying great popularity among the fair sex. In addition to Russian films, the actor also starred in the Hollywood movie "Vampire Academy", playing one of the main roles there.
Alexey Chadov
Alexey Chadov first appeared on the television screen as a child, playing a small role as a hare in the film "Little Red Riding Hood". His next role was in the film "War", which brought the actor great popularity. The film βLove in the Big Cityβ is also very famous, where the actor is a Russian man, a little careless, but very charming, who is trying to save his love.
Konstantin Kryukov
Actor Konstantin Kryukov spent all his childhood abroad in Switzerland. He graduated from art school and is still interested in painting. In addition to working in films, Konstantin devotes all his time to jewelry. He develops his own jewelry design, and also produces jewelry collections. In the films, Konstantin presents the image of an attractive but frivolous guy who easily turns the head of any girl. As a Russian actor, the man starred in a large number of Russian melodramas.
